Synthesis of organic compounds in ecosystems

  • Living organisms need a supply of organic compounds in order to respire and build their tissues, e.g.:

    • carbohydrates

    • proteins

    • lipids

  • In ecosystems, organic compounds are synthesised by plants during photosynthesis

  • Plants use the carbon present in carbon dioxide to produce organic molecules

    • In terrestrial ecosystems plants use CO2 from the atmosphere

    • In aquatic ecosystems plants use dissolved CO2

  • Plants are described as the primary producers in an ecosystem because they produce their own organic molecules

  • The organic compounds produced by plants are passed to other organisms in an ecosystem when herbivores consume plant tissue

Diagram showing producers (plants, bacteria, algae) using photosynthesis and consumers (animals, most bacteria, fungi) consuming for energy.
Photosynthetic organisms, such as plants, produce their own organic compounds which can then be passed on to consumers
